Financial health, per its FY2024 accounts

The accounts state that the charity recorded a deficit on unrestricted general funds of £30,051 for the year ended 31 December 2024, following a return to paying full fees to the Jewish Joint Burial Society. The trustees report that while some reassurance can be taken from consistency with adjusted prior year results, such deficits are not sustainable and require urgent alignment of income and expenditure through fee increases and cost reviews.

Reserves position: below the charity's own stated reserves policy (held: £48k; policy: two months of operating expenditure)
Increased operating costs have led to a deficit on general reserves for the year of £30,051, leaving general reserves carried forward of £47,588. — page 6
